BiMnPO5 with ferromagnetic Mn2+-(μ-O)2-Mn2+ units: a model for magnetic exchange in edge-linked Mn2+O6 octahedra

Chem Commun (Camb). 2021 Jul 15;57(57):7027-7030. doi: 10.1039/d1cc02595c.

Abstract

Magnetic interactions within Mn-(μ-O)2-Mn pairs are crucial to the function of some essential enzymes and catalysts, but their nature is unclear. Neutron diffraction reveals that similar units in BiMnPO5 show ferromagnetic coupling which has been rationalized by density functional theory modelling and calculations of magnetic exchange energies. The results are important to many solid state and biological systems.
